About the role
- Support the design and development of complex aerospace components and systems within the Hydro-Mechanical, Actuation & Pneumatic Valve Design Group
- Involved in all phases of the product development lifecycle, including conceptual design, detailed design, testing, and qualification
- Work from detailed component requirements and perform necessary analyses and specification reviews to create fully engineered physical components
- Evaluate critical design factors such as manufacturability, material and equipment availability, interchangeability, serviceability, strength-to-weight ratios, cost, and compliance with specifications
- Perform both 1-D hand calculations and advanced 3-D simulations (FEA and CFD) to analyze and validate component performance
- Develop detailed 3-D solid models using tools like NX Unigraphics aiding in packaging assessments and weight estimation
- Capture and protect innovative ideas by leveraging internal intellectual property (IP) tools and processes
- Create detailed layouts, sketches, and technical documentation to support component design and manufacturing improvements
- Contribute to the advancement of Collins Aerospace’s analysis capabilities by developing, testing, and validating new methods and tools
- Create custom in-house tools to streamline and enhance engineering analysis workflows where applicable
